Fatal Pedestrian Crash on Arden Way in Sacramento County

A fatal pedestrian crash on Arden Way in Sacramento on Tuesday evening, March 31, 2026, resulted in a death in the Arden-Arcade area of Sacramento County. According to the California Highway Patrol, the crash occurred around 7:44 p.m. on Arden Way.

Emergency Response and Life-Saving Efforts

Authorities reported that a pedestrian was struck by a vehicle of unknown description. Fire department personnel responded to the scene and took over CPR efforts upon arrival. Despite those efforts, the pedestrian was pronounced deceased.

Officials are still investigating the collision and have not yet shared details on how it happened or the identity of the victim.

Safety Reminder: Pedestrian Visibility and Driver Awareness

Evening hours can significantly reduce visibility for both drivers and pedestrians. Drivers should slow down, remain attentive, and watch for individuals crossing roadways, especially in busy corridors. Pedestrians are encouraged to use designated crossings and wear visible or reflective clothing to increase safety.
